Grok is undressing anyone, including minors

Grok is undressing anyone, including minors

2 Ocak 2026The Verge

🤖AI Özeti

xAI's Grok has introduced a controversial feature that allows users to edit images, including removing clothing from pictures, without the consent of the original poster. This capability raises significant ethical concerns, particularly as it can involve minors. The lack of notification for the original poster further complicates the issue, highlighting potential privacy violations.
